Enter the ancient gateway of Verona at Porta Borsari with your AI guide. Once the main entrance to the Roman city, this majestic white limestone façade bridges imperial history with modern life. What you can do: Discover Roman Origins: Snap a photo of the double arches or the elegant rows of arched windows. The app instantly explains its role as the principal entrance (Decumanus Maximus) and a symbol of Roman engineering and might. Hidden Stories: Point your camera at the inscription on the architrave to hear about Emperor Gallienus and the year 265 AD. The AI reveals why the name changed from "Porta Iovia" to "Borsari"—referencing the medieval tax collectors who once stationed here. Admire the rare elegance of the Arco dei Gavi with your AI guide. This white limestone masterpiece isn’t just a Roman monument—it’s a survivor, dismantled by Napoleon and rebuilt stone by stone. What you can do: Spot the Signature: Snap a photo of the inscription "L. Vitruvius Cerdo." The app explains the rarity of a Roman architect signing his work and the massive influence this arch had on Renaissance artists like Palladio. A Story of Survival: Tap the map to uncover its dramatic journey. The AI reveals how French troops demolished it in 1805 to clear the road, and how the stones were hidden for over a century before being reassembled here in 1932. Discover the pinnacle of Renaissance military architecture at Porta Palio with your AI guide. Designed by Michele Sanmicheli, this gate turns a defensive wall into a magnificent work of art. What you can do: Master the Details: Snap a photo of the massive Doric columns or the diamond-pointed rustication. The app explains Sanmicheli's genius in blending Roman grandeur with Venetian fortification to impress anyone entering the city. Two Distinct Faces: Walk through to compare the façades. The AI reveals the strategic contrast: the outer side is grand and imposing to intimidate arrivals, while the city-facing side remains simple and functional. Explore at Your Pace: Wander the surrounding green spaces or the moat area. The guide narrates the gate's construction in the 1550s and its crucial role in the Venetian Republic’s defense strategy.
